The Power of Positive Psychology

So, what exactly is this positive psychology and why should we care? At its core, it’s about shifting focus from shortcomings to strengths, a bit like turning a dark cloud into a silver lining. It’s about creating an environment where each team member is seen for their individual talents, making the workplace a haven rather than a battleground.

This mindset doesn’t just uplift individuals; it spreads like wildfire within the team. Collaboration blossoms! Ideas flow freely! Before you know it, a culture of trust sprouts, encouraging team members to take risks without the fear of failure weighing them down. When was the last time you felt truly appreciated at work? The Ripple Effects of Strengths-Based Leadership

You see, the benefits don’t stop at just a happier team. Emphasizing strengths aligns individual capabilities with organizational goals, creating a powerful synergy. This alignment leads to higher levels of productivity and fulfillment both for the individuals and the organization. It’s this unique blend that can elevate an organization from good to great.

But what happens if a leader ignores their team’s well-being? Well, the stark contrast is evident. Team members feel overlooked, leading to decreased motivation, higher turnover rates, and a workplace atmosphere that feels more like a chore than an engaging environment. Who would want that?
